Output efc625bae93c375487fa5a5004358cdac064362dba8d4a2effa81a5fe2eea996:0

value
243431
script pubkey
OP_0 OP_PUSHBYTES_20 2e85e0c3689662ef30e5c9359474b4e619c3ab9b
address
bc1q96z7psmgje3w7v89ey6ega95ucvu82um8hh9ft
transaction
efc625bae93c375487fa5a5004358cdac064362dba8d4a2effa81a5fe2eea996
spent
true